I'm kinda confused about Advanced Combo... at Max level I get a 30% boost in damage but apparently it's not the case. So, I'm just wondering...
If my Brandish did 10k with just the first five orbs, how much would it do once I have all 10 orbs with max Advanced Combo?
5 orbs (max combo, 0 AC) gives you a 1.4 multiplier, while 10 orbs (max AC) gives you a 1.9 multiplier.
